Meridian Business Campus

Meridian Business Campus is a 660-acre multiuse business campus constructed by CMD Midwest, Inc., and owned by Duke Weeks. The Campus is bordered on the east by Route 59, on the north by the Burlington Northern Railroad, on the west by the Elgin, Joliet and Eastern Railroad, and on the south by Exchange Avenue.

Three development zones are included in the park: office and commercial, research and service, and light industrial facilities. The site is zoned light manufacturing.

The business campus is located near Fox Valley Shopping Center, numerous restaurants, banks, financial institutions, health and recreation facilities, a hotel, child care facilities, and a medical care center. The Burlington Northern Commuter Train Station and the first Michael Jordan Golf Center are located within the business park.

About 250 acres of the Meridian Business Campus have been filled by such companies as Chicago AAA Motor Club, Nissan Motor Corporation, Federal Express, JVC, Westell, Warner/Elektra/Atlantic, Weyerhauser and Cabot Corporation.
